#ca53ff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ca53ff is composed of 79.2% red, 32.5%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.8% cyan, 67.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 281.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 66.3%. #ca53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6ff with #9500ff.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#ca53ff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030005 is the darkest color, while #faf0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ca53ff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ca2b0 is the less saturated color, while #ca53ff is the most saturated one.
